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

For a unique Montreal experience, consider visiting the following hidden gems and local favorites:

  • Saint Joseph's Oratory: Marvel at the grandeur of this religious site, known as the largest shrine dedicated to Saint Joseph in the world. Enjoy the stunning architecture and panoramic views of the city from its elevated location.
  • Mile End Neighborhood: Explore the trendy Mile End neighborhood, known for its artistic vibe, independent boutiques, cafes, and vibrant street art. Grab a bagel from one of the famous bakeries or browse through vinyl records in the local shops.
  • La Distillerie No. 1: Visit this speakeasy-style bar for unique and creative cocktails served in mason jars. With its cozy atmosphere and extensive drink menu, it's the perfect place to relax and enjoy the evening with your friends.
